Transaction 17351bd70af2169bda0ca7e2268070708f53151387724350f8aeabffb43129ab
1 Input
1 Output
-
17351bd70af2169bda0ca7e2268070708f53151387724350f8aeabffb43129ab:0
- value
- 509026
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e674b141595eea204eefead6c7ca4fe58d42fff OP_EQUALVERIFY OP_CHECKSIG
- address
- 12KACdSHu3GTzvnvfKsezuaapxFaNza2uo